Pierre‐Olivier Polack is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Pierre‐Olivier Polack has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ience, 12 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 3 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Pierre‐Olivier Polack's work include Neural dynamics and brain function (14 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(10 papers) and Visual perception and processing mechanisms (6 papers). Pierre‐Olivier Polack is often cited by papers focused on Neural dynamics and brain function (14 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(10 papers) and Visual perception and processing mechanisms (6 papers). Pierre‐Olivier Polack collaborates with scholars based in United States, France and Hungary. Pierre‐Olivier Polack's co-authors include Peyman Golshani, Jonathan Friedman, Stéphane Charpier, Antoine Depaulis, Colin Deransart, Isabelle Guillemain, Diego Contreras, Mario Chávez, Séverine Mahon and Michael S. Fanselow and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Neuron and Journal of Neuroscience.
